Parallel Imported | BigCommerce long-term project

Introduction to our client

Parallel Imported is a leading New Zealand-based importer specializing in electronics, fragrances, home goods, and sunglasses. Utilizing the robust capabilities of BigCommerce, we have partnered with them for an extensive and ongoing development project aimed at enhancing their online store's functionality and user experience.

PIM API Integration and Feature Development

A key aspect of this project was the advanced integration of the Product Information Management (PIM) API, which allowed us to pull relevant metafield data to power essential features such as delivery labels and stock information for the inventory that is not tracked in BigCommerce.

Enhanced Payment Methods for Seamless Transactions

We connected additional payment methods such as GEM and Afterpay, customized their front-end appearance on Product Page and made sure the API connection to external payment platforms is smooth and correct.

Dynamic and Customizable Mega Menu

To enhance site navigation, we developed a fully customizable Mega Menu from scratch. The Menu in BigCommerce is a weak place, as there are very limited or inconvenient customization methods provided by default in most existing themes. We created a Mega Menu that is not connected to the default category structure, and allows our merchant to fill in whatever links they want in free order.

We also created global widgets for 'menu banners' and 'top products,' allowing the merchant to easily manage content through BigCommerce’s page builder mode. This feature enables effortless updates to the menu, with top products requiring only the product ID and banners easily linked to any page. The Mega Menu content is visible in DOM and indexed by Google which is aligned with SEO best practices.

Parallel Imported Mega Menu

Sticky Header for Improved User Navigation

We also implemented a custom sticky header that only appears when the user scrolls up, creating a cleaner browsing experience. The sticky header provides easy access to navigation without overwhelming the user.

Dynamic Delivery Time Frames Based on Metafields

We implemented a dynamic system that adjusts delivery time frames based on product metafields. Pulling supplier information from the PIM, we ensure that customers always receive accurate shipping information, taking into account the specific product’s delivery conditions.

Automatic Product Swatches for Solo Products

To further enhance product visualization, we developed an automatic swatch system for solo products. By recognizing connected products based on their titles (e.g., iPhone 15 Pro - Black and iPhone 15 Pro - Blue), the system pulls relevant images and links to generate product swatches on the product detail page. This solution significantly improves the user experience, allowing customers to easily browse different product variations.

Parallel Product Swatches

Ongoing Quality Assurance and Code refactoring

Our collaboration includes regular quarterly quality assurance audits and code refactoring. This proactive approach ensures that the website remains optimized by removing outdated JavaScript and CSS, preventing code bloat, and maintaining fast load times.